Acute and Subchronic Toxicity Assessment of Conventional Soxhlet Cymbopogon citratus Leaves Extracts in Sprague–Dawley Rats
Table 6
Effect of six weeks of oral administration of CSE C. citratus ethanolic extract on urine parameters at termination.
| Parameters | Treatment group | Control | Conventional soxhlet ethanolic C. citratus extract | 200 mg/kg | 600 mg/kg | 1200 mg/kg |
| Glucose (mg/dl) | — | — | — | — | Bilirubin (mg/dl) | — | — | — | — | Ketones (mg/dl) | — | — | — | — | Specific gravity (g/ml) | 1.020 ± 0.005 | 1.016 ± 0.003 | 1.020 ± 0.000 | 1.016 ± 0.003 | Blood | — | — | — | — | pH | 7.38 ± 0.25 | 7.50 ± 0.50 | 7.00 ± 0.00 | 7.62 ± 0.48 | Protein (g/L) | — | — | — | — | Nitrite | — | — | — | — | Leukocyte (μl) | — | — | — | — | Urobilinogen (mg/dl) | N | N | N | N |
|
|
Results presented as means ± SEM of n = 6, (—): absent, (N): normal.
